From Yogurt website:

Greek yogurt does have a few nutritional advantages over regular yogurt: Since it's a more concentrated product, it packs a few more grams of protein per serving. It's also a bit lower in sugar and carbs., since lactose, a form of sugar present in all dairy products, is removed with the whey.

They're excellent sources of calcium and good sources of protein, their bacteria cultures aid digestion.
